                  • U guys know what it's like as soon as that oil is up to temp, the flex of the right foot, that first tug-to-the left on the steering wheel, magnificent. 180kph, 7 gears literally at my fingertips, windows open and the glorious turbo whistle ringing off the hills as I accelerate, change down, brake, accelerate again and again. Left, right, right, change down and brake hard, waaaay more corner entry speed than I'm used to, the car squirming on it's brand new tyres, the smell of engine, gearbox, drivetrain becoming one only briefly savoured for a millisecond before 3rd, 4th, 5th all disappear in quick succession. The sun glistening through the trees, beautiful orange, golden hour has never been better. The look of disdain of the mk5 Gti owner as they are dispatched in the glare of 2 illuminated, red, facing "L's", like bookends.
                    Brake hard now, indicate right, come to a stop, fun is over for now, but not for long. Car is filthy but seemingly smiling at me, like a whippet after an afternoon run, panting but smiling at it's owner.

                    Welcome, Polo GTI.

                              • Hi. First a big thanks to all the informative posts on this site. I have been reading for 3 months now but it was only after I picked up my CW Polo GTi from Wagga (after a relatively short 3 months wait) that I felt that I needed to post. What a car!! I have it now for 48 hours and can't find enough excuses to drive it. The drive from Wagga back to Sydney was a treat as I prescribe to a balance of the 2 schools of thought - give it some but mix it up. Pulled up at the BP after 550+ kms and only had 28 litres to top up!! Happy days!
